So this lady calls and wants us to cook – like next week….


so this lady calls and asks us to cook for her 50 person family reunion… like next week.  I told her that is too close of a time frame and I am booked.  So I am trying to figure out if I can help her with a recommendation – then I figured I better find out why this last minute deal?

So she tells me she booked this BBQ caterer in Lexington 10 months ago – then he calls one week before the reunion and says he’s going to Myrtle Beach with his family – “I am canceling”.  I couldn’t even believe it and I told her I’d help.

So Cindy and I told her if she could be patient with us (eat at 7, not 5), we could help.  Cindy and I coached little league on Saturday till 12:30 in Danville (we were all packed up), hopped in the truck with the smoker behind, food in the coolers, etc and hit the road.  2hrs+ we pulled in to the event.  They were sure happy to see us – they looked hungry!  :-)

We started the smoker and started cooking.  3.5 hours later, we had the best smoked Chicken, Brats and Pulled Pork they ever ate.

Here’s the funny part – we were ready to serve at 6:30 – and we couldn’t find the hostess (my lady)!  so Cindy called her on the phone and we found her – she was in the house upstairs or something…  She came out, gathered everyone – not a hard job – these poor people have been smelling the smoker cook their BBQ with Hickory for the last 3.5 hours!  The smell is always amazing.

Fed everyone – seconds and thirds, put all the leftovers in freezer bags (although I doubt any of it lasted till the next morning – there were some big appetites there), put all our stuff away, made sure the area was spotless and jetted out of there at 8:30-9pm.  Got home at 11:30pm and felt great that we were able to pull that off last minute for them.

ABTs – ok, I am not going to tell you what ABT stands for, the pics speak for themselves


Jalapenos cored and seeded (that is where the heat is), filled with aged cheddar, cream cheese, secret rub, wrapped in bacon and smoked for 1.5-2 hrs.  Can’t ever make too many of these – but 3 per person is usually the magic number – although I could founder on these myself.  :-)
